This is what I found at the Pay It Link site:
Pay It Link is a web-based service that makes requesting money via PayPal™ easy. Now you don’t have to log into your account to use the request money feature.
Simply enter your PayPal™ email address, a description, the price and click submit. We’ll provide you with a short URL that you can share via:- Email
- Instant Message (AIM, MSN, ICQ, and more)
- Twitter
- or any method that allows a link
Pay It Link makes it extremely easy for your clients to pay you money. They simply click a link & log into their PayPal™ account. Couldn’t be easier.
